Subject[PATCH v2 5/5] ACPI / boot: Don't handle SCI on HW reduced platforms
Date
WIP

Signed-off-by: Andy Shevchenko <andriy.shevchenko@linux.intel.com>
---
arch/x86/kernel/acpi/boot.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/boot.c b/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/boot.c
index 71c0feae60a4..4413cc2f7c3c 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/boot.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/boot.c
@@ -1184,7 +1184,7 @@ static int __init acpi_parse_madt_ioapic_entries(void)
* If BIOS did not supply an INT_SRC_OVR for the SCI
* pretend we got one so we can set the SCI flags.
*/
- if (!acpi_sci_override_gsi)
+ if (!acpi_sci_override_gsi && !acpi_gbl_reduced_hardware)
acpi_sci_ioapic_setup(acpi_gbl_FADT.sci_interrupt, 0, 0,
acpi_gbl_FADT.sci_interrupt);
